PROGRAMS FOR MODELLING RANDOM EVENTS FOR THE SAKE OF LEARNING BOTH PROGRAMMING AND MATHEMATICS.

Authors

DOI:

https://doi.org/10.14308/ite000533

Keywords:

programming, MATLAB, discrete random processes

Abstract

     MATLAB-programs of some discrete random event has been developed and intended (1) as an exercise at the study of Algorithmization and Programming Course, and (2) for carrying out some "experiments" by lecturing the Course of Probability and Statistics Theory, or at its self-study by students. The programs allows to do several probabilistic experiments in a necessary amount M,using the random number generator, to count up frequency of "favorable events" appearance and compare it to theoretical probability. This displays the Law of large numbers, i.e. approaching experimental results to theory with unlimited increase of М. The work, however, lies not only in this pragmatic result. It should encourage students to study problems of Probability Theory by means of creation appropriate computer codes. The most easy and quick way to this leads to MATLAB-environment. That is why the paper suggests principles of programming in it along with creation of graphical user interface (GUI).

Downloads

Download data is not yet available.

Metrics

Metrics Loading ...

References

Гнеденко Б.В., Хинчин А.Я. Элементарное введение в теорию вероятностей. М.: Наука, 1970. – 168 с.

Вентцель Е.С., Овчаров Л.А. Теория вероятностей и ее инженерные приложения. М.: Наука, 1988. – 480 с.

https://ru.wikipedia.org/wiki/. Статья "Схема Бернулли".

Зеленяк О.П. Стереометрія з комп’ютером? – Інформаційні технології в освіті. 2013. № 15. – С. 146 – 157.

Кудін А.П., Кархут В.Я. Мультимедійний навчально-методичний комплекс з вивчення теоретичної механіки. Інформаційні технології в освіті. 2013. № 15. – С. 52 – 59.

Бабенко М.І. Методи комп'ютерного моделювання при розв’язуванні фізичних задач в курсі фізики вищої та середньої школи. Інформаційні технології в освіті. 2013. № 17.

– С. 77 -81.

Кулик А.С., Гавриленко Е.В. Разработка компьютерных обучающих программ на кафедре систем управления летательными аппаратами. Авиационно-космическая техника и технология, Харьков: ХАИ, № 4/111, 2014. – С. 97- 105.

Обруцький А.М. Фізика на Паскалі: Практикум. – Дніпропетровськ, 2006. – 224 с.

Азарсков В.М., Гаєв Є.О. Сучасне програмування. Модулі 1,2: “Програмування та математика із другом MATLABом”. К.: НАУ, 2014. – 256 с.

Фройденталь Г. Математика как педагогическая задача. Ч. ІІ. – М.: Просвещение, 1983. – 192 с.

https://ru.wikipedia.org/wiki/. Статья “Игральная кость”

http://ru.wikipedia.org/wiki/Распре-деление_Бернулли. “Распределение Бернулли”.

Мельник И.В. Базовые принципы матричного программирования и их реализация в системе научно-технических расчетов MATLAB. – Вестник Херсонского н-т. ун-та, 2013, № 2 (47). – С. 220 – 224.

Патий Е. 19 ступеней вверх, или История графических пользовательских интерфейсов. "IT News", № 18/2005. http://smoking-room.ru/data/ pnp/gui_history

Статьи http://en.wikipedia.org/wiki/ Yahtzee, http://de.wikipedia.org/wiki/ Kniffel, https://ru.wikipedia.org/wiki. “Покер на костях”.

Gnedenko B.V., Hinchin A.Ya. Elementarnoe vvedenie v teoriyu veroyatnostey. M.: Nauka, 1970. – 168 s.

Venttsel E.S., Ovcharov L.A. Teoriya veroyatnostey i ee inzhenernyie prilozheniya. M.: Nauka, 1988. – 480 s.

https://ru.wikipedia.org/wiki/. Statya "Shema Bernulli".

Zelenyak O.P. StereometrIya z komp’yuterom? – InformatsIynI tehnologIYi v osvItI. 2013. # 15. – S. 146 – 157.

KudIn A.P., Karhut V.Ya. MultimedIyniy navchalno-metodichniy kompleks z vivchennya teoretichnoYi mehanIki. InformatsIynI tehnologIYi v osvItI. 2013. # 15. – S. 52 – 59.

Babenko M.I. Metodi komp'yuternogo modelyuvannya pri rozv’yazuvannI fIzichnih zadach v kursI fIziki vischoYi ta serednoYi shkoli. InformatsIynI tehnologIYi v osvItI. 2013. # 17.

– S. 77 -81.

Kulik A.S., Gavrilenko E.V. Razrabotka kompyuternyih obuchayuschih programm na kafedre sistem upravleniya letatelnyimi apparatami. Aviatsionno-kosmicheskaya tehnika i tehnologiya, Harkov: HAI, # 4/111, 2014. – S. 97- 105.

Obrutskiy A.M. FIzika na PaskalI: Praktikum. – DnIpropetrovsk, 2006. – 224 s.

Azarskov V.M., GaEv E.O. Suchasne programuvannya. ModulI 1,2: “Programuvannya ta matematika Iz drugom MATLABom”. K.: NAU, 2014. – 256 s.

Froydental G. Matematika kak pedagogicheskaya zadacha. Ch. II. – M.: Prosveschenie, 1983. – 192 s.

https://ru.wikipedia.org/wiki/. Statya “Igralnaya kost”

http://ru.wikipedia.org/wiki/Raspre-delenie_Bernulli. “Raspredelenie Bernulli”.

Melnik I.V. Bazovyie printsipyi matrichnogo programmirovaniya i ih realizatsiya v sisteme nauchno-tehnicheskih raschetov MATLAB. – Vestnik Hersonskogo n-t. un-ta, 2013, # 2 (47). – S. 220 – 224.

Patiy E. 19 stupeney vverh, ili Istoriya graficheskih polzovatelskih interfeysov. "IT News", # 18/2005. http://smoking-room.ru/data/ pnp/gui_history

Stati http://en.wikipedia.org/wiki/ Yahtzee, http://de.wikipedia.org/wiki/ Kniffel, https://ru.wikipedia.org/wiki. “Poker na kostyah”.

Published

28.11.2015

How to Cite

Gayev Е., Martich М., & Tarak Г. (2015). PROGRAMS FOR MODELLING RANDOM EVENTS FOR THE SAKE OF LEARNING BOTH PROGRAMMING AND MATHEMATICS. Journal of Information Technologies in Education (ITE), (23), 030–042. https://doi.org/10.14308/ite000533